This Asian country is ready to pay its visitors to increase the number of tourists

Taipei City: The tourism sector experienced a major crisis during the covid period. At present, the tourism sector is trying to lift all the restrictions and be active once more. As a part of this, many countries are putting forward many projects. Taiwan has come up with a great offer to attract tourists following covid. Taiwan has announced a plan to provide benefits of $165 per traveler.

In this way, benefits of 82 million dollars will be provided. Lucky draw, discounts, discount on flight tickets are all ways to transfer money. Discounts are available, including when purchasing electronic equipment. Travel agencies offer special discounts to those who bring a certain number of people to Taiwan.

Four percent of Taiwan’s GDP comes from the tourism sector. Nine lakh tourists visited Taiwan last year. However, due to the dispute with China, tourists from Hong Kong and Macau are not coming to Taiwan.
